Electricity radiant heaters function by emitting infrared radiation, which warms objects and people directly in its path, rather than heating the surrounding air. This contrasts with traditional convection heaters, which warm the air that then circulates throughout the room. As the infrared waves are absorbed by surfaces and objects, they release heat, creating a comfortable and cosy environment. This method allows for rapid and targeted heating, making it ideal for specific areas or zones within your home. The efficiency of this direct heating process means less energy is wasted, and warmth is felt almost immediately after the heater is turned on. Unlike conventional heaters, there is no delay in waiting for the entire room to warm up. Furthermore, electricity radiant heaters do not rely on air circulation, reducing the spread of dust and allergens, making them a healthier option for those with respiratory concerns. The simplicity and effectiveness of this heating method make it a popular choice for modern homes.

When selecting an electricity radiant heater, assess the size of the space you intend to heat to determine the appropriate power level. Larger areas might necessitate a more powerful unit or multiple heaters. Consider the different types available: wall-mounted units save floor space and are ideal for smaller rooms, while freestanding models offer flexibility in placement. Underfloor heating is perfect for a seamless and invisible installation, particularly in bathrooms or kitchens. Factor in your home’s specific heating needs and design preferences. Additionally, look for features such as adjustable thermostats, remote controls, and energy-saving settings to enhance convenience and efficiency.
Installing an electricity radiant heater requires careful planning to ensure optimal performance and safety. First, identify a suitable location where the heater can operate without obstructions such as furniture or curtains. Follow the manufacturer’s installation instructions closely. For wall-mounted models, use the appropriate mounting brackets and ensure they are securely fixed to the wall. Freestanding models should be placed on stable surfaces. If your unit requires wiring, it’s prudent to hire a qualified electrician to handle the electrical connections, ensuring compliance with local regulations. Maintain a safe distance from flammable materials and check that the heater’s power supply matches your home’s electrical capacity.

Modern electricity radiant heaters are designed with multiple safety features to ensure user protection. Overheat protection is a common feature that automatically shuts off the heater if it reaches unsafe temperature levels, preventing potential hazards. Many models also come with tip-over switches that turn off the unit if it is accidentally knocked over, offering added safety, especially in homes with children or pets.
Additionally, some heaters are equipped with cool-to-touch surfaces, reducing the risk of burns upon contact. Child lock settings are also available in certain models, providing peace of mind for families. Thermal cut-off mechanisms act as an additional safeguard by cutting power if the heater’s internal components become too hot.
For enhanced safety, ensure the heater is placed on a stable surface and away from flammable materials such as curtains or furniture. Adhering to the manufacturer’s guidelines for installation and operation is crucial. It’s also advisable to periodically inspect the heater’s cords and plugs for any signs of wear or damage, and replace them if necessary.
